Leftover Wok
The perfect leftover wok recipe with a picture and simple step-by-step instructions.
- 350 g Remaining sweet and sour vegetables / see my recipe: *)
- 250 g Remaining broccoli
- 2 piece Eggs
- 2 big pinches Coarse sea salt from the mill
- 2 big pinches Colorful pepper from the mill
- Clean the broccoli, cut into small florets, clean the stem and cut into small diamonds. Heat the wok with the rest of the vegetables sweet and sour, add the broccoli (florets and diamonds from the stalk) and simmer / cook with the lid on for about 10 minutes. Beat the eggs, whisk with coarse sea salt from the mill (2 big pinches) and colored pepper from the mill (2 big pinches) and pour / distribute in a thread-like manner in the wok. Let everything simmer until the egg has congealed and the liquid has boiled away. Serve the leftover wok. *) Hearty meatball skewers on sweet and sour vegetables
